The Graduate Certificate is aligned with the eleven International Coaching Federation (ICF) core coaching competencies and prepares a student for additional training which could result in coach certification.

  • Setting the Foundation
  1. Meeting Ethical Guidelines and Professional Standards
  2. Establishing the Coaching Agreement
  • Co-creating the Relationship
  1. Establishing Trust and Intimacy with the Client
  2. Coaching Presence
  • Communicating Effectively
  1. Active Listening
  2. Powerful Questioning
  3. Direct Communication
  • Facilitating Learning and Results
  1. Creating Awareness
  2. Designing Actions
  3. Planning and Goal Setting
  4. Managing Progress and Accountability
